摘 要: | 国道G212线南部至定水路面改建工程为依托,对共振碎石化的施工技术和工艺进行了研究;根据贝克曼梁测得的弯沉,计算得到G212线南部至定水碎石化层的当量回弹模量范围为215~277MPa,说明其有足够的承载力且模量值较均匀,可作加铺层的基层直接使用。

Abstract: | Based on Nanbu-Dingshui pavement reconstruction project along National Highway G212, the construction technology and process of resonance rubblization is studied. According to the deflection measured with Benkelman beam, the range of the equivalent modulus of elasticity of rubblization layer thereof could be calculated as 215 -277 MPa, which shows the layer has enough bearing capacity and even modulus to be used as base of the pavement overlay directly. |
